

Click the "+" button in the bottom right corner – or the "+ Create" button next to the search bar – then select "Create knowby from scratch" to open the editor.
Firstly, select your base language. This is the language you will use to create your knowby and will serve as the source for all future translations. Select your language from the list and confirm.
Note: This is a one-time setup and cannot be changed later.
First, you’ll see the "Details" tab. Start by uploading a cover image – click Browse in the gray area or drag and drop an image in. Crop it to 16:9.
Every change is saved automatically – if you close the tab or lose connection, your progress is kept as a draft.
Click the Title field and enter the name of your knowby (max 60 characters).
In the Description field, add a short summary of what this guide covers (max 280 characters).
Optionally, you can also set:
📅 Next review date — when this guide should be reviewed
⏱️ Estimated completion time – how long you expect the user to need to complete the knowby, shown to users on the start screen
🔍 Internal reference ID — for faster search
Click the Steps tab on the left to start building your steps. You'll see step thumbnails on the left, a media upload area in the center, and a text area on the right.
To add media to a step click Browse or drag and drop a file into the gray area.
After uploading, you can edit your media using the built-in editor:
✂️ Trim videos by dragging the blue bars
🔲 Crop to your preferred ratio (16:9, 3:4, square, etc.)
✏️ Annotate with lines, shapes, and text
🎯 Add stickers for emphasis
To add a new step, click the "+" button below the current step (highlighted in purple) in the thumbnails of steps panel on the left.
To reorder steps – drag and drop them using the thumbnail panel, or use the three-dot menu next to the + button for Move up, Move down, and Delete options.
You can move steps by holding the current step (highlighted in purple) and dragging it to a new position between the steps.
Add instructional text for each step. The text editor supports:
B Bold, I Italic
Aa Heading styles with font size control
Numbered and bulleted lists
Blockquotes with colours
Hyperlinks
Linked knowbys – reference another guide directly in the step
You can add a form field to any step to collect responses, confirmations, or images from users. In the Steps tab, open the Form panel on the right and add your field.
Available field types: short answer, long answer, checkbox, single choice, multiple choice, dropdown, and image upload.
To add translations to your knowby, click the Languages tab on the left side of the screen.
On this screen, you’ll see:
A language management panel at the top – for adding, deleting, and tracking verified translations.
Thumbnails of steps on the left for navigation.
Text boxes – the original text on the left (editable only from other tabs) and the translation on the right.
To add a language, type in the search bar and click the language you need.
The system will automatically translate your title, description, and all steps.
Translations are labeled Unverified until you review them.
Review each step's translation in the text box on the right. When it's correct, check Translation verified. Once all steps are verified, a green checkmark appears next to the language.
💡 You can add multiple languages. Even unverified translations will still appear in the knowby as an automated translation in the list.
If the text in any step or in Details is updated after translation, the system will show a red badge on the Languages tab. When you open it, a banner will highlight which steps have changed and mark the language as no longer verified.
To re-verify, click the flagged steps and hit Update Translation – or update the text manually and check Translation verified.
When you're done, click Done in the top right. You'll land on the draft preview screen — ready to publish.
